Why We Started Casper Wraps
Most wrap shops sell the same materials and use the same install spec regardless of where the vehicle operates. Wyoming doesn’t work that way. UV at 5,150 feet, 150 to 200 freeze-thaw cycles per year, sustained 40+ mph wind, and the abrasive grit that comes with Powder River Basin oilfield work all combine to make Casper one of the harshest vinyl environments in North America. Wraps that perform fine in Phoenix or Houston fail visibly here in 18 months.
Casper Wraps exists to install wraps that actually survive Wyoming. That means premium cast vinyl only, UV-rated overlaminate on every print job, reinforced edge sealing on outdoor-stored vehicles, and material specification matched to the work the vehicle actually does. Oilfield service trucks get gravel-resistant overlaminate. Trailers stored outdoors get rivet-by-rivet edge sealing. Healthcare fleets get the color-saturation specification their brand standards demand.

Material Partners
We install premium cast vinyl from two manufacturers. Each one’s strengths cover different use cases. Both share our quality floor.
3M
3M Controltac IJ180Cv3 print film, 3M Wrap Film Series 2080 color change film, 3M 8518 / 8519 overlaminates, 3M Edge Sealer 3950. Pressure-activated adhesive with strong cold-climate performance. Our default for fleet wraps, oilfield service trucks, and most printed-graphic applications. Manufacturer-rated 7-year vertical durability.
Avery Dennison
Avery MPI 1105 Easy Apply RS print film, Avery Supreme Wrap Film (SW900) color change film, Avery DOL 1460 overlaminate. Easy Apply RS adhesive allows install repositioning. Specified when color saturation matters most: healthcare fleets, mobile retail, tourism. Manufacturer-rated 8-year durability with overlaminate.
